According to our latest research, the global Grid Decarbonization market size will reach USD 78350 million in 2031, growing at a CAGR of 11.5% over the analysis period.

Grid decarbonization refers to the process of transitioning energy generation systems from fossil fuel-based power sources to low-carbon or zero-carbon sources in order to reduce greenhouse gas (GHG) emissions. Grid decarbonization is a fundamental component of the global transition to a sustainable and low-carbon future. It involves a multi-faceted approach, combining renewable energy adoption, energy storage, grid modernization, electrification of end-use sectors, and supportive policies. While the transition faces challenges such as intermittency, infrastructure needs, and regulatory barriers, the benefits—such as reduced emissions, improved health, and enhanced energy security—make grid decarbonization a priority for governments, industries, and societies worldwide.
